Transaction 3c8cc160b39c200c61aaa3353a3d18edbd42646fae026ab3ba88a3da7e3630b9
1 Input
1 Output
-
3c8cc160b39c200c61aaa3353a3d18edbd42646fae026ab3ba88a3da7e3630b9:0
- value
- 37847223
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b7d14267fdf333f56937305a82cc06c5c7c0512
- address
- bc1q0d73gfnlmuen745nwvz6stxqd3w8cpgjan0mrw